Output 31f525bc112da2ce1f8452dc637cb156bf741c97aaf21389dd0133d16e6026fb: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 612e42b0063295a7184e1741f21fd471aa013130 OP_EQUAL
address
3AYrtPQQMYaMEE7LzQEg8W7MfLy3YzVmF7
transaction
31f525bc112da2ce1f8452dc637cb156bf741c97aaf21389dd0133d16e6026fb
spent
true